In the rapidly evolving landscape of mobile app development, security remains a paramount concern for both users and developers. As the number of mobile applications continues to grow, so does the need for robust security measures. One technology that has gained prominence for its potential impact on mobile app security is blockchain. In this comprehensive analysis, we delve into the ways blockchain is shaping the security landscape of mobile applications, with a focus on the practices adopted by mobile app development firm.

1. Decentralized Security Architecture:

Blockchain's decentralized nature fundamentally changes the traditional approach to mobile app security. By distributing data across a network of nodes rather than relying on a central authority, blockchain reduces the risk of a single point of failure. This innovative security architecture aligns with the best practices adopted by top app developers, ensuring that mobile applications are more resilient against cyber threats.

2. Immutable Data Storage:

One of the key features of blockchain is its immutable ledger, where once data is recorded, it cannot be altered. Top app developers leverage this aspect to enhance the integrity of user data within mobile applications. By utilizing blockchain for secure and tamper-proof storage, developers can assure users that their sensitive information is protected from unauthorized modifications.

3. Enhanced Authentication Mechanisms:

Blockchain introduces robust authentication mechanisms, particularly through the use of cryptographic techniques. Top app developers are integrating blockchain-based authentication methods to fortify user identity verification processes. This not only enhances security but also streamlines the user experience, striking a balance between robust protection and user convenience.

4. Smart Contracts for Secure Transactions:

Smart contracts, self-executing contracts with the terms of the agreement directly written into code, are a notable application of blockchain technology. Top app developers are integrating smart contracts into mobile applications to ensure secure and transparent transactions. This is particularly beneficial for apps involving financial transactions, where trust and security are paramount.

5. Supply Chain Security:

For mobile apps that rely on external APIs, plugins, or third-party integrations, blockchain provides a secure framework to verify the integrity and security of these components. Top app developers prioritize supply chain security by leveraging blockchain's transparency and traceability, reducing the risk of compromised external elements compromising the overall app security.

Conclusion:

In conclusion, the impact of blockchain on mobile app security is substantial, with top app developers leading the way in adopting these innovative practices. The decentralized architecture, immutable data storage, enhanced authentication mechanisms, smart contracts, and supply chain security all contribute to a more secure mobile app ecosystem. As technology continues to advance, embracing blockchain for mobile app security is not just a trend but a strategic move to safeguard user data and build trust in the ever-expanding world of mobile applications.